Background technique
Diabetic cardiomyopathy (diabetic cardiomyopathy, DCM) is to betide diabetic, cannot use height Other pathogenic factors such as blood pressure, coronary heart disease are mainly shown as that Ventricular diastolic function is not complete, advanced stage come the cardiomyopathies explained in early days Then based on systolic dysfunction, Yi Yinfa congestive heart failure.Diabetes myocardial fibrosis (myocardialfibrosis, MF) occurs mainly in DCM advanced stage, is most common and serious diabetic cardiovascular complications, Show as the hyper-proliferative of Cardiac Fibroblasts (cardiac fibroblasts, CFs), interstitial collagen largely gathers, Each Collagen Type VI proportional imbalance etc., Yi Yinqi myocardial stiffness increases, ventricular compliance declines, and then leads to the contraction of ventricle and relax Insufficiency is opened, heart failure, arrhythmia cordis, cardiogenic shock, or even sudden death are caused.It is tight just because of diabetes MF harm Again, domestic and foreign scholars study it increasingly deep, and the control efficiency of traditional Chinese medicine is also increasingly affirmed.
Summary of the invention
The object of the present invention is to provide a kind of traditional Chinese herbal decoctions and its preparation for preventing and treating diabetic cardiomyopathy myocardial fibrosis Method.
To achieve the goals above, the technical solution that the application uses are as follows:
A kind of traditional Chinese herbal decoction preventing and treating diabetic cardiomyopathy myocardial fibrosis, is made of, and described Chinese medical extract and water The content ratio of Chinese medical extract and the water is 15mg~30mg:100mL;
The Chinese medical extract is pr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:
10 parts~20 parts of kuh-seng, 10 parts~20 parts of turmeric, 10 parts~20 parts of orange peel, 10 parts of silybum marianum seed~15 parts, grape 10 parts~20 parts of seed, 8 parts~13 parts of Tai Bai Aralia wood, 8 parts~13 parts of Fructus Aurantii, 8 parts~13 parts of ginkgo, 3 parts~5 parts of ginseng, leech 3 Part~5 parts and 3 parts~5 parts of the coptis.
Further, it is made of Chinese medical extract and water, and the content ratio of the Chinese medical extract and the water is 25mg: 100mL;
The Chinese medical extract is pr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ight:
15 parts of kuh-seng, 15 parts of turmeric, 15 parts of orange peel, 12 parts of silybum marianum seed, 15 parts of grape pip, 10 parts of Tai Bai Aralia wood, Fructus Aurantii 11 parts, 10 parts of ginkgo, 4 parts of ginseng, 4 parts of leech and 4 parts of the coptis.
In addition, present invention also provides the preparation sides of the traditional Chinese herbal decoction of above-mentioned prevention and treatment diabetic cardiomyopathy myocardial fibrosis Method includes the following steps:
S1, first, in accordance with needing to weigh bulk pharmaceutical chemicals, be added 10~15 times of weight into bulk pharmaceutical chemicals, and concentration be 75%~ 80% ethyl alcohol is stripped operation after impregnating 30min~40min;The temperature of extracting be 60 DEG C~80 DEG C, the time be 4h~ 10h, filtering, obtains the first filtrate and filter residue, for use;
S2,8~10 times of weight are added into filter residue obtained in S1, and concentration be 75%~80% and ethyl alcohol, surpass Sound extracts 2h~3h, and filtering obtains the second filtrate, for use;
S3, the first filtrate is merged with the second filtrate, obtains the first medical fluid, and the first medical fluid is subtracted at 50 DEG C~80 DEG C Pressure concentration, obtains concentrate;
S4, concentrate is spray-dried, obtains Chinese medical extract;After Chinese medical extract is mixed with water again, obtain The traditional Chinese herbal decoction for preventing and treating diabetic cardiomyopathy myocardial fibrosis.
Further, the spray drying condition are as follows: inlet air temperature is 95 DEG C~100 DEG C, and leaving air temp is 80 DEG C~90 DEG C, temperature of charge is 60 DEG C~70 DEG C, and atomizing pressure is 0.2Mpa~0.3Mpa, and spray velocity is 10mL/s~12mL/s.
Further, the condition of the ultrasonic extraction in the S2 are as follows: supersonic frequency is 70~120Hz, and temperature is 40~70 ℃。
The pharmacological action of each taste bulk pharmaceutical chemicals:
Kuh-seng, return heart, liver, stomach, large intestine, bladder meridian;There are heat-clearing and damp-drying drug, desinsection, the function of diuresis.For hot dysentery, hematochezia is yellow Subcutaneous ulcer renal shutdown, leukorrhea with reddish discharge, swelling of vulva pruritus vulvae, eczema, wet sore, pruitus, castor control trichomonas vaginitis outside.
Turmeric, returns spleen, Liver Channel;Cure mainly chest and abdomen swelling and pain, shoulder arm numbness pain, it is pained unbearably, postpartum blood pain, ringworm sore is initial, menstruation It is uncomfortable, amenorrhoea, traumatic injury etc..
Orange peel enters spleen, lung two passes through;Promoting the circulation of qi resolving sputum, invigorating the spleen temperature stomach and other effects.
Silybum marianum seed contains silymarin, can be substantially reduced TGF-β 1, MMP-9, TIMP-1 in diabetes cardiac muscular tissue And the level of MMP-9/TIMP-1 plays the heart by adjusting the cytokine levels and ECM composition that participate in DCM pathogenesis Flesh protective effect.
Grape pip, has free radical resisting, and skin, the effect of protection brain etc. are protected in reducing blood lipid.
Too white Aralia wood is specialty in China Midwest Qin_Ba mountain areas and remaining arteries and veins, and main ingredient is triterpenoid saponin.Acrid flavour, It is bitter;It is mild-natured.Return liver, stomach, kidney channel.Early stage data shows that Tai Bai Aralia wood has hypoglycemic, reducing blood lipid, anti-oxidant and anti-glycosylation Effect.
Fructus Aurantii is peptic, tonic, carminative and corrigent, is cured cold, indigestion, cough ant phlegm, uterine prolapse, The diseases such as rectal prolapse.
Ginkgo is mild-natured, bitterness sweet in flavor, slightly poisonous;Enter lung, kidney channel;Cholesterol levels in blood of human body are reduced, artery is prevented Hardening;Except the deposition ingredient on vascular wall, improve hemorheological property, promote the deformability of red blood cell, reduces blood viscosity, Keep blood flow unobstructed, cerebral hemorrhage and cerebral infarction can be prevented and treated.
Ginseng, sweet in flavor, slight bitter are warm-natured, flat.Returns spleen, lung channel, the heart channel of Hang-Shaoyin.Tonifying Qi, prevent prolapse are promoted the production of body fluid, and are calmed the nerves, intelligence development.For height Blood pressure diseases, cardiac muscular dystrophy, coronary sclerosis, angina pectoris etc. have certain therapeutic effect, can mitigate various diseases Shape.Levis diabetes patient's glucose in urine can be made to reduce, in after isocratic diabetes patient takes ginseng, although it is unobvious to reduce blood glucose effect, But most overall health of patients make moderate progress, such as thirsty sense symptom disappears or mitigates.
Leech has treatment apoplexy, hypertension, the clear stasis of blood, amenorrhoea, traumatic injury and other effects.
The coptis has the effect of heat-clearing and damp-drying drug, purging fire for removing toxin.For damp and hot feeling of fullness, acid regurgitation, dysentery, jaundice, high fever are vomitted Coma, heart-fire hyperactivity, dysphoria and insomnia, blood-head tells nosebleed, hot eyes, toothache are quenched one's thirst, carbuncle swells furunculosis;Eczema, wet sore, ear canal stream are controlled outside Purulence.
